The Verdict

These scooters are in different price categories. The Apollo Air Pro ($799) is the budget-friendly choice, while the YUME M11 offers premium performance at a higher price point.

Frequently Asked Questions

Which is cheaper, the Apollo Air Pro or the YUME M11?

The Apollo Air Pro is $2,000 cheaper at $799, compared to $2,799 for the YUME M11.

Which is faster, the Apollo Air Pro or YUME M11?

The YUME M11 is faster with a top speed of 56.3 mph, compared to 18.8 mph for the Apollo Air Pro.

Which has better range, the Apollo Air Pro or YUME M11?

The YUME M11 has a longer range of 45.6 miles per charge, compared to 17.7 miles for the Apollo Air Pro.

Which is lighter, the Apollo Air Pro or YUME M11?

The Apollo Air Pro is lighter at 36.8 lbs, making it more portable than the YUME M11 at 60.8 lbs.
